All controllers, dongles, hubs found on here are "build it yourself". You purchase the pc board(s) from RJ, and get the parts from either a co-op or buy them yourself through an electronics supply house. In the wiki link above, there is a hardware section that goes to each piece of equipment. At the equipment you will find a link to a Mouser.com project listing that tells all of the items you require (and prices) for each project. Each (ALL) project needs to be assembled, soldered, and programmed (Do It Yourself). Its not the easiest way to get into the hobby, but its what keeps the prices down for the equipment.
I don't know your skill level with soldering, but you can find a lot of helpful tutorials on the net
